I have always only had the hips cleared through our Canadian registry, OVC. I was told the hips must be the equivelant of an OFA "Good" to pass. Since I like the fact that OFA gives an actual grading, I had my last bitch certified through OFA, and her hips came back Excellent as well. I have decided to certify with OFA from now on, because I really also like the fact that hip scores are published online. |

stairs will not effect his hip structure - but can aggravate poorly structured hips. my girl is OFA excellant and ran up and down the stairs from day one - often more than once at a time - she thought it a great game. my boy was carried for weeks. he has bad hips. | Congrats, Emily & Edy! It's great news for Bingley!!  | Kerry you are correct, if a dog does not have the gene for hd it can do whatever without affecting hips, but you don't know until you x-ray, therefore I advise my puppy people not to let the puppy run up stairs all day long etc.
With doing this you might be able to prevent worse , i.e fair to good, borderline to fair.
